      i totally agree.say what you will about mccall,he's 46 & other then helenius there isn't a top 50 guy fighting the level of competition the last 2.5 yeasrs that mccall has. at age 44-46 he has fought lance whitaker, franklin lawrence, timur ibragimov, fres oquendo, cedric boswell, & damian wills. he's gone 4-2 over that stretch.wach has to take him very seriously or else he could be lying on his back.mccall was 260 vs boswell, 248 vs wills & has said he will be in the 230s fight night.this could be a very interesting fight. the numbers are in wach's favor but mccall can go 12 & has knock out power so who knows?
